Starting at £114.90
£107.97
Starting at £122.80
£93.92
Starting at £63.34
£61.45
Starting at £219.45
£203.65
Starting at £140.36
£133.43
Starting at £693.46
£624.99
Starting at £131.67
£125.53
Starting at £35.11
£34.23
Starting at £43.89
£25.46
Starting at £129.91
£124.65
Starting at £121.14
£116.75
Starting at £226.47
£209.79
Starting at £412.57
£375.70